Investigating Tumor Perfusion by Hyperpolarized (13)C MRI with Comparison to Conventional Gadolinium Contrast-Enhanced MRI and Pathology in Orthotopic Human GBM Xenografts
PURPOSE: Dissolution dynamic nuclear polarization (DNP) enables the acquisition of (13)C magnetic resonance data with a high sensitivity.
